Graphics | 29.2% is a below average 3D score (RTX 2060S = 100%). This GPU can handle older games but it will struggle to render recent games at resolutions greater than 1080p. (Note: general computing tasks don't require 3D graphics) |
Boot Drive | 81.3% is a very good SSD score. This drive is suitable for moderate workstation use, it will facilitate fast boots, responsive applications and ensure minimum IO wait times. |
Memory | 32GB is enough RAM to run any version of Windows and it's far more than any current game requires. 32GB will also allow for large file and system caches, virtual machine hosting, software development, video editing and batch multimedia processing. |
OS Version | Although Windows 7 is still a viable option, it's now 14 years and 9 months old. This system should be upgraded to Windows 10 which is generally faster and has an improved set of core utilities including better versions of explorer and task manager. |
